TIME’S RUNNING OUT IN BACKPACKER TAX SAGA

The clock is ticking for the Coallition Government to get the revised backpacker tax over the line.
With only two sittings left for the year, Member for New England Barnaby Joyce is concerned the legislation will be blocked by Labor, leaving farmers across the electorate in limbo.
“We only have two weeks of parliament left otherwise the rate goes back to 32.5 cents. So, we’ve worked hard to come up with a reasonable solution that is fair to the Australian workers in the fields or in the shed and attracts the foreign workers in that we need.”
The current proposal is to drop the tax rate to 19 and a half per cent to encourage foreign workers to Australia.
